本文根据自由基聚合原理,采用HPEG-600聚醚、丙烯酸和丙烯酸甲酯合成低粘型聚羧酸系减水剂。主要探讨了酸醚比、丙烯酸甲酯的用量、反应温度和聚合物分子量大小对性能的影响。最后,混凝土性能测试表明本试验所合成的聚羧酸系减水剂具有明显的降黏效果。
